Alessi, illycafe and Michele De Lucchi’s Coffee Collaboration

Alessi, illycafe and Michele De Lucchi’s Coffee Collaboration

With the launch of Pulcina – a new take on the traditional moka pot – the all-star trio serves up the perfect cup of espresso.

Alessi’s New York redux

Alessi’s New York redux

Asymptote Architecture’s Hani Rashid recently refreshed his original concept for the Soho flagship of the Italian home accessories manufacturer. The renewed space accomodates more of the brand’s fanciful and functional works, without the clutter.

New York Design Week: Alessi and Cranbrook

New York Design Week: Alessi and Cranbrook

The Italian home accessories manufacturer teams up with the Cranbrook Academy of Art for a collection of alumni-designed tableware that resembles elegant metal sculptures.
